Drop VirtualBox support
Tails' VirtualBox support is really bad (e.g. #19324 (closed), #18781 (closed)) due to lack of guest additions (#18728 (closed)).
The manual test we do each release feels is really useless. In fact, when the test was originally added it was specifically about the guest additions, presumably because they kept breaking. What do we get from testing Tails in VirtualBox without guest additions? If we get anything I doubt it is worth it, and that there are more important things we do not manually test.
I don't think we in good faith can continue to advertise VirtualBox support to users in this poor state. We we're already considering completely dropping VirtualBox support back in Oct 2021 when we stopped compiling the guest additions, but we had some optimistic ideas that didn't pan out (#18643 (comment 179126), #18666 (closed)), and here we are now, over two years later, still pretending things are good or are going to get better. IMHO it is high time to drop it, and even if someone comes up with another optimistic plan I don't think it should prevent us from dropping it, instead let them restore the docs/tests when they actually land the fix in Tails.
